Like some others have mentioned in the past my PT also jumps out of float when mowing. I mow a heavy 3 acres and the terrain is less than ideal. So I simply drilled and tapped a 5/16" hole precisely under the steel base of the joystick(when in the float position) and put a float lock knob. All thats required is a half turn after I push the joystick up and its locked. It also works the other way. If Im strictly doing bucket work not needing float I screw in a half turn and it locks me out of float.(Im rather new so it keeps me from overzealously pushing it into float by accident). I used a strong compression spring to always keep it under tension and beneath the spring is a piece of clear tubing to act as a stop to tighten to.
Back to my less than ideal lawn... it really rattled the quick attach around. It was actually embarasing how much noise it made so I drilled and tapped three 3/8" holes on top of the mowers quick attach...No more noise and yes the quick attach still works albeit a little fussier.
